How much do production associate machine oper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for production associate machine operator in Corydon, IN is $16.42,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.13 and $18.22 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a production associate machine operator?

Production Associate Machine Operators are workers responsible for operating and maintaining machinery in manufacturing environments. Their main duties include setting up machines, monitoring production processes, performing quality checks, and troubleshooting equipment issues. They ensure that products are made efficiently and meet quality standards, often working as part of a team on a production line. Safety and attention to detail are important in this role, as is the ability to follow instructions and meet production go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a production associate machine operator?

To thrive as a Production Associate Machine Operator, you need a solid understanding of manufacturing processes, attention to detail,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with operating machinery, basic computer systems, and safety protocols is typically required, and some roles may prefer certifications such as OSHA training. Strong problem-solving skills, teamwork, and the ability to follow instructions precisely help individuals excel in this role. These skills ensure safe, efficient, and high-quality production, minimizing errors and maintaining workflow in a manufacturing environment.

What are some common challenges faced by production associate machine operators, and how can they be addressed?

Production Associate Machine Operators often encounter challenges such as maintaining consistent quality while meeting production quotas, adapting to fast-paced environments, and troubleshooting mechanical issues on the fly. To address these, it’s important to develop strong attention to detail, communicate effectively with team members and supervisors, and proactively participate in equipment training sessions. Many employers also encourage operators to suggest process improvements, which can lead to increased efficiency and recognition within the team.

PTG Silicones is seeking to fill our need for a Machine Operator. You will be responsible for operating injection molding machines to mold and manufacture silicone components. You will also perform visual inspections of products being manufactured to meet quality specifications.

This opportunity is for both part-time and full-time employment seekers. We are currently looking for multiple candidates to work:

  • Part-time to full-time hours (up to 40 hours per week)
  • Monday - Friday, between the hours of 6 am - 6 pm
  • Pay range: $18.00 to $22.00 per hour, paid weekly

This is a temporary position through the end of 2026, with an opportunity to develop this into continued employment beyond that time. 

At PTG Silicones we feature a state-of-the-art manufacturing facility that's fully equipped for automated, world-class silicone injection molding. Our goal is to produce high-quality parts and sub-assemblies that meet or exceed specification, are delivered on time, and are competitively priced.
